1/2 Research, led by @unswbees Dr Malgorzata Lagisz, has found that among 182 international societies for ecology and evolution researchers only 26% offered fee concessions for postdoctoral researchers. Read the full story, here: unsw.edu.au/news/2025/02/the…
1
2
259
2/2 “Membership fees of professional academic societies are generally not equitable and need to be carefully reconsidered in order to support the individuals from historically marginalised and underrepresented groups in science,” says Dr Lagisz.

New research, co-authored by UNSW’s @ProfJoelPearson, sheds light on the neural mechanisms behind aphantasia - a condition where individuals cannot voluntarily generate visual mental imagery. Find out more: unsw.edu.au/newsroom/news/20…
